Output 57a2911471425676aeb290851729470e1dd03f79d8553c70e219ecfa9845461a:0

value
17811127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5938ed2226361833e9d235ee2221c61cd229f48e OP_EQUAL
address
39pnFvdbUXxys7iZt1ZHd7vaJRQRrPeod7
transaction
57a2911471425676aeb290851729470e1dd03f79d8553c70e219ecfa9845461a
spent
false

2 Sat Ranges